programming/c#

[정정]SQLParameter로 null값이 온 경우 check하는 방법

happy4u 2005. 5. 31. 15:03

OUTPUT parameter에 null값이 담겨져 온 경우 C#에서 비교하는 방법

paramNull.IsNullable = true; <-- 이 부분은 없어도 비교 하는데는 문제가 없습니다.

 

 

if(paramNull.Value == DBNull.Value)

{

           ....

}

 

그냥 null로 되는 줄 알았는데, 안되고 DBNull이라는 객체를 이용해야 한다.

isNullable이라는 속성은 null값을 허용하겠느냐를 결정하는 건데, default가 false이다.